Survivor: Micronesia- “I’m Gonna Fix Her”

by State School Elitist

So, we didn’t take any notes during the episode last week, was James referring to his injured digit? Or was he trying to be menacing with this faux-threat? At this point in the game with no numbers and no strategy, the only way James could be menacing is if he was physically so a la Joey on this season’s Real World. Yeah. I watched the Real World last night after basketball because Orlando was pwning Detroit, fucking sue me.

Anyway, James’ untimely and unwanted (at least from the producers standpoint) departure from the game was only a small fraction of this episode. He probably had the best reappearance of a medical evacuation ever though, showing up to tribal with an IV. It reminded me of South Park’s parody of the 2000 election in which Mr. Garrison brought in the dying kindergartner to vote for class president.

His appearance at Tribal Council was only the tip of the iceberg, because this episode was probably the best use of the immunity idol since Earl turned it against Alex and his gaggle of cronies. Mainly because it was nice to see it effectively used for once and Amanda was absolutely radiant when she played the thing. It’s nice to see that while my one Survivor (semi but was fading quickly) crush is dispatched, a new one is making a name for herself.

It wasn’t so much that she played it as it was how she played it. From the get-go when she came back from immunity challenge to empty her bag (presumably a little over-eager to do so, but those are bygones at this point), to aligning with one other person (Parvati, bleh) to assist in distracting everyone else while she dug for the idol, to seeing where everyone stood before she actually went in search of the thing, to that fucking Oscar worthy performance at Tribal Council and her subsequent strut up to Probst to put the idol in play, we thoroughly enjoyed the entire spectacle. The only way it was getting any better is if they voted out Natalie instead of Alexis who was literally on her last leg anyways, or if Natalie just spontaneously combusted into flames.

But I think the decision to vote out Alexis was part of the strategy on Amanda’s part. Since Amanda wanted vile Natalie out of the game and Parvati wanted Alexis (I have no fucking clue why, and just when I’m beginning to change my opinion of Parvati, she insists on some shit like this and kills any perceived good will), it was a good compromise to make so Parvati doesn’t run off and tell the other four people about the idol. So even though I disagree with the actual final decision, I concede that it was phenomenal game play.

In other news, Erik could make a bit of an immunity run in the next few episodes. You wouldn’t expect it because he has the hair of a 55 year-old woman and the physique and mindset of a twelve year-old boy (look at his squealing excitement to have is brother and Jeff Probst within close proximity of each other), but he’s deceptively competitive, and aside from Parvati in challenges that require balance and agility he’s in pretty good standing in everything else. We actually let out an audible yelp when he took the target challenge in such convincing fashion.

We’ll never figure out why all the women didn’t just aim for only one person’s bottles in their alliance if their ultimate goal was to have an all female final five. But we suppose that their SURVIVAL instincts kicked in (Huh? Am I right or am I right, people? High five!). Either that or they are over-confident, unoriginal idiots. Historically speaking on Survivor, that has traditionally been the case.

The reward challenge and actual reward were kind of bland. We never much care about the “besmirch each other behind their backs then embarrass everyone by way of Jeff Probst” challenge. At least Alexis got that one taste of victory before being ousted, but ironically enough the person she sent to immunity ended up leading to her torch being snuffed. Why is everyone this season so apprehensive to go to exile island when they know damn well that there is an immunity idol to be had?

Nothing much else happened, we were happy to see that alliance have to turn on each other after their ugly cockiness last week, and judging from the previews last week we expect to see more of the same.
